SUPER-HIGH-SPEED INJECTION CONTROL
The super-high-speed injection on the multistage injection machine shortens the fill time, increases the transmittable casting pressure, makes a sound surface structure and improves the internal quality by fully compressing the porosities.


SUPER-LOW-SPEED INJECTION CONTROL
Our original super-low-speed injection control stabilizes the velocity, which is the most important in laminar-flow die casting, and makes possible die cast parts with no gas entrapment.

PRESSURE BUILDUP CONTROL
Shibaura Machine makes its die casting machines possible to control freely the pressure buildup time by using its unique two-cylinder type injection, allowing that control to suit each quality requirement.

ELECTROMAGNETIC PUMP MELT FEED

ELECTROMAGNETIC PUMP MELT FEED
The electromagnetic pump melt-feed-system reduces the shot-time-lag from the time of melt feed start until the time of injection start, and yields strength products free of scattered chill layers. In addition, it lowers the content of oxides since the melt does not come in contact with air.

LOCAL SQUEEZE (THE SQUEEZE MASTER)

LOCAL SQUEEZE (THE SQUEEZE MASTER)
It controls the state of pressurizing from the end of melt fill to the end of solidification suiting to its degree. The automatic compensation of pressure, flow rate or timing will materialize an ideal shrinkage porosity countermeasure.

VACUUM CONTROL AND GAS PRESSURE DETECTION

VACUUM CONTROL AND GAS PRESSURE DETECTION
It has made it possible to shut off the vacuum valve always before the end of shot to prevent the melt from getting into the vacuum valve. Controlling the vacuum degree inside the die makes the quality consistent.

SLEEVE

HEAT-INSULATING SHOT-SLEEVE
In the face of steel material, heat conductivity equivalent to that of a ceramics has been achieved on this special material sleeve. Without a worry of breakage on handling, it prevents the melt temperature drop and reduces the generation of solidified structures. (For Magnesium)

LONGEVITY SHOT-SLEEVE
Compared to conventional SKD material sleeves, the life span is expected to be five to 10 times, making it contribute to consistent qualities.

DIE CASTING MONITOR EQUIPMENT (CASTVIEW)

DIE CASTING MONITOR EQUIPMENT (CASTVIEW)
All kinds of analog data such as injection speed, pressure, temperature, flow rate, gas pressure, etc in conjunction with time are to be easily digitized and monitored. With "the management by seeing", the quantitative management is materialized.
